水产养殖无人船监控管理信息系统的设计

来源 :上海海洋大学 | 被引量 : 0次 | 上传用户:cxz2004
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着自动控制技术、物联网技术、网络通信技术的不断发展,传统水产养殖行业也朝着数字化和智能化的方向在迅速发展。人民日益增长的水产品需求、渔业高质量发展的行业需求,更加凸显了传统水产养殖过程中依靠人工劳作而形成的粗放、简单的养殖方式的落后。养殖效率的提高、养殖成本的降低、养殖质量的改善、养殖过程的规范等,成为水产养殖行业领域的发展目标。针对传统人工撑船投喂方式人工成本高,传统岸边机械投料装置存在的抛洒面积受限、无法实现均匀、定点投料等问题,水产养殖无人船成为近期研究热点,可在远离岸边的宽阔水域中实现定点、定量、定时自动投喂,可降低饲料系数、降低养殖成本。如何实现水产养殖无人船的高效实用,监控管理信息系统的设计成为亟待解决的关键问题。在深入探究水产养殖过程、养殖户需求、水产养殖无人船的设计与实现的基础上,在深入了解监控管理信息系统设计与实现的国内外研究进展的基础上,借助于云计算平台技术、4G通信技术,WEB开发技术、Android开发技术等,设计并实现了水产养殖无人船监控管理信息系统。系统通过一个云平台服务器加两种用户终端监控管理的模式,实现水产养殖无人船相关数据的存储与管理;实现远程用户对水产养殖环境监控、无人船自动巡航饲料投喂控制、投喂任务调度管理、无人船运行维护管理等功能,提高养殖效率,改善养殖户工作方式,并能为科学喂养提供数据支撑,推动数字渔业、智能渔业的进一步发展。针对系统需要实现的功能,对系统进行了功能需求分析、非功能需求分析及系统用例分析。通过对系统用户进行划分,详细地分析并明确了各类用户的功能需求和权限范围。针对需求分析,借助于统一建模工具设计了整个管理信息系统的总体架构,并进行功能模块划分、数据库设计和系统通信方式设计。其中,功能模块包括投喂管理模块、用户管理模块、留言管理模块、无人船管理模块、池塘管理模块和设备管理模块。基于My SQL进行数据库设计,建立的数据库表包含无人船信息、电池信息、池塘信息等共12个数据表,满足了信息存储和管理的需要,保证了数据的查询效率,同时满足系统的安全和性能需要。为提高无人船饲料投喂效率、降低无人船运行成本,在不考虑多船间存在碰撞问题的前提下,建立了多船多任务工作模式下的定点饲料投喂任务分配调度模型。模型将任务完成时间、无人船电池余量、无人船饲料仓最大容量等作为约束条件,将完成投喂饲料任务组合的无人船巡航路径长度和时间作为优化目标,优化设计了进行任务分配的改进的蝴蝶优化算法,基于Matlab进行了仿真实验。结果显示,采用改进的蝴蝶优化算法实现了对无人船饲料投喂任务的高效分配。基于阿里云服务,搭建了系统云服务器,基于MQTT协议,实现无人船与云服务器间的数据传输;基于HTTP协议,实现客户端与云服务器间的数据传输。针对远程养殖户客户端,主要使用Java开发语言,采用主流的开发框架SSM(Spring+Spring MVC+My Batis),采用基于MVC(Model-View-Controller)模式的整体架构,将系统划分为模型、视图、控制器三层,设计实现了Android客户端和Web客户端。
其他文献
随着科技的不断进步和生产力水平的不断提高,当代机械加工设备的加工精度、加工速度和集成化程度愈来愈高。目前,由于计算机技术的不断发展,有关于机械加工设备的健康监测系统日益完善,先进的检测设备和高效准确的故障诊断算法是确保机械设备检测系统安全、稳定运行的关键。其中对于故障诊断算法方面的研究主要集中于对机械设备的工作状况的实时监测。滚动轴承被誉为机械的“关节”,作为机械加工设备的重要组成部分,特别是在旋
学位
随着科学技术的不断进步,无人机的应用正在朝着多功能化、智能化、自主化的方向发展。无人机所能搭载的工作机构,如视觉机构、武器装备、采摘装置和喷施装置等,都说明了无人机应用的可拓展性。其中,工作任务为植物保护的无人机应用已经相对完善,通过无人机高空作业的优势,逐渐代替了人工的劳作,可以实现播撒药液、监测预警等功能。但是,在植物生长中还需要对冗余树枝、枯枝和干扰树枝进行修剪,现在基本采用的都是人工作业的
学位
风力发电作为一项清洁、环保、可再生能源,一直被许多国家视为能源战略发展目标。我国地理环境复杂,拥有广阔的草原、戈壁和绵长的海岸线,它们都为国家风力资源发展创造了良好的先决条件。大型风力发电机主要安装在地势平坦、风力资源丰富、平均风速高的地区,在实际选址时海岸、高原等地区是主要目标,这些地区偏远且环境恶劣对设备的维护造成极大的障碍。风电机组在使用过程中逐渐发生劣化,导致故障率升高。为了确保机组可靠度
学位
四足机器人具有灵活的避障能力和攀爬能力,可以穿越崎岖地形。合理的步态控制策略是实现四足机器人在复杂地形下的稳定运动的前提条件。目前四足机器人步态控制方法可以分为两大类:基于模型的步态控制方法和基于数据的步态控制方法。基于模型的控制方法主要包括摆动相轨迹规划和支撑相力矩控制。基于数据的步态控制方法又分为两类:1)将轨迹规划和深度强化学习算法相结合。2)独立使用深度强化学习算法从零开始学习,不需要使用
学位
中国作为海洋、航运大国,有着狭长的海岸线和纵横交错的内河航运线。在建设海洋强国、发展海上丝绸之路的时代背景下,我国的海事监管部门的决策执法需要加速建设以适应时代需求。船舶检测技术是海事监管的重要一环,常用于船舶流量统计、船舶行为监控、指导水上运输等重要工作,提高船舶检测技术有助于海事监管部门向高效化、智能化发展。因此,本文展开了基于深度学习的船舶识别检测方法研究。首先,本文大致概括了从传统算法到基
学位
近年来,水产捕捞产量日益增长,海洋渔业资源的发展得到了国家越来越广泛的关注,如何采用更智能、更自动化的方式对捕捞后的鱼类进行处理是一个亟待解决的问题。传统的水产捕捞与分类多为粗放型流水线模式,以人工观察为主,简单的机器操作为辅,养殖户继续遵循传统的水产养殖方法,仅凭经验管理水产品的分级销售。随着人口老龄化导致的人工成本升高,传统的检测分类方法中又面临着劳动力的大量消耗和效率低下的问题,后续的销售成
学位
随着“十四五”海洋经济发展等规划提出,水下机器人等海洋装备对于资源探测和利用具有重要的意义。其中具有大变形运动特点的扑翼式运动模式可以有效提高机器鱼的机动灵活性,是水下机器人的研究热点。此种运动是指模拟鱼类中位/双鳍运动模式,获得更好的推进效率和完成悬停、转向等特殊动作,相比传统刚性结构拥有更优异的流体性能,产生的流体扰动更小,具有旷阔的应用前景。本论文以蝠鲼类的扑翼运动模式和鱼类运动流体力学为基
学位
<正>2019年教育部考试中心正式发布了《中国高考评价体系》,由“一核四层四翼”三部分组成。“一核”中的“立德树人”贯穿了新高考的始终,高考命题会落实在“四层”中的“核心价值”上。作为“四翼”也会通过“四层”载体呈现出来:“必备知识”体现了基础性;“关键能力”主要指发现问题、分析问题与解决问题的能力,主要体现了应用性;“学科素养”反映在历史学科就是五大核心素养,体现了德智体美劳全面发展的综合性;
期刊
随着社会经济和工业的发展,人们对于能源的需求逐渐增加。如今,传统的石油化石燃料已经逐渐满足不了日渐庞大的消耗量。正是在这样的前提下,寻求新的能源被逐渐提上日程。风力做为一种优质的资源,凭借清洁可再生等优势开始被大规模利用。由于海风相比陆风更有优势,所以风力发电也逐步从陆地转向海洋,由浅海转向深海。随着深度的不断加深,传统固定式风电平台造价高、适应性弱等弊端逐渐凸显。为了走向深海寻求更多资源,浮式风
学位
由于冷链行业的快速发展和居民消费水平的不断升级,社会对配送过程温度多样性的需求越来越高,对配送时间准确度的要求也更加严格。本文在冷链物流多温共配的研究背景下,考虑了路网的时变性以及碳排放因素,通过对多温共配、时变路网和碳排放等要素的分析,研究了时变路网下考虑碳排放的蓄冷式多温共配的路径优化问题。首先,本文从蓄冷式多温共配系统的设计、时变路网的处理以及碳排放的处理等方面进行分析。蓄冷式多温共配系统的
学位